The Marquette Golden Eagles say aloha to the VCU Rams on the first day of the Maui Jim Invitational.  Shaka Smart might not be the coach at VCU anymore (insert your own 2014 Marquette coaching search joke here), but the Rams don't look much different under former Smart assistant Mike Rhoades.
